Transaction 34927ad62150ea3f9dcbfba994f153060a656feafef9fe113bae655e4baab629
1 Input
1 Output
-
34927ad62150ea3f9dcbfba994f153060a656feafef9fe113bae655e4baab629:0
- value
- 149000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 19f14bb01a1c9b07e4371d6a8103abf364c826ca OP_EQUAL
- address
- 344BsraVvFdtRzHyRKm8aTrvHYkuvKCsUP